The unemployment rate in Louisville, AL, is 11.20%, with job growth of -1.30%. Future job growth over the next ten years is predicted to be 26.20%.

Louisville, AL Taxes

Louisville, AL,sales tax rate is 8.00%. Income tax is 5.00%.

Louisville, AL Income and Salaries

The income per capita is $13,855, which includes all adults and children. The median household income is $23,481.
